Horst Bertl
Horst Bertl (born March 24, 1947 ) is a former German soccer player . He played as a striker .
Life
Bertl began his Bundesliga career at Hannover 96 . In 1972 he moved to Borussia Dortmund in the Regionalliga West . In 1974 he moved back to the Bundesliga for Hamburger SV , with whom he celebrated his greatest successes: With HSV he won the DFB Cup in 1976 , the European Cup Winners ' Cup in 1977 and the German championship in 1979 . In the 1979/80 season he ended his career with Houston Hurricane in the North American Soccer League .
Club overview
- Bremerhaven 93 (1969-1970)
- Hanover 96 (1970–1972)
- Borussia Dortmund (1972–1974)
- Hamburger SV (1974–1979)
- Houston Hurricane (USA) (1979–1980)
successes
- German championship 1979
- European Cup Winners' Cup 1977
- DFB Cup 1975/76
- Internal top scorer of Hamburger SV 1974/75 (8 goals; together with Willi Reimann )
